Abstract

An organic light-emitting display device wherein an IR drop across a first electrode can be prevented. The organic light-emitting display device includes a substrate; a plurality of stripe-shaped first electrodes disposed on the substrate and extending in a first direction; a plurality of stripe-shaped first insulators extending in a second direction to cross the stripe-shaped first electrodes; a plurality of stripe-shaped second electrodes disposed between the stripe-shaped first insulators to extend in the same direction as the stripe-shaped first insulators and cross the stripe-shaped first electrodes; an intermediate layer disposed at positions where the stripe-shaped first electrodes and the stripe-shaped second electrodes cross and including an emission layer; and first conductors disposed at positions where the stripe-shaped first electrodes and the stripe-shaped first insulators intersect and between the stripe-shaped first electrodes and the stripe-shaped first insulators.

Claims (46)

1. An organic light-emitting display device comprising:

a substrate;

first electrodes disposed on the substrate and extending in a first direction;

first insulators extending in a second direction to cross the first electrodes;

second electrodes disposed between the first insulators to extend in the same direction as the first insulators and to cross the first electrodes;

an intermediate layer comprising an emission layer is disposed between the first electrodes and the second electrodes where the first electrodes and the second electrodes cross; and

first conductors disposed at positions where the first electrodes and the first insulators cross and disposed between the first electrodes and the first insulators.

2.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 1 , wherein the first conductors are formed of Cr, Mg, Ag, Mo, MoW or Al.

3.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 1 , further comprising:

a terminal unit on edges of the substrate.

4.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 3 , wherein terminals of the terminal unit are formed of the same material as the first conductors.

5.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 3 , wherein the terminals of the terminal unit have a multi-layer structure comprising at least two layers.

6.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 5 , wherein the terminals of the terminal unit comprise a first layer which is formed of the same material as the first electrodes and a second layer which is formed of the same material as the first conductors.

7.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 1 , wherein the first insulators are formed so as to cover the first conductors.

8.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 1 , further comprising

second insulators disposed between the first electrodes.

9.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 8 , wherein the first insulators and the second insulators are integrally formed.

10.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 1 , wherein the first electrodes are transparent.

11. The organic light-emitting display device of claim 10 , wherein the first electrodes are formed of ITO, IZO, ZnO or In 2 O 3 .
